Understanding the Living Antique Copper Finish
Copper is renowned for being a living finish, meaning it interacts with its environment, water, and daily use to continuously develop its character. Think of it like aged leather or fine hardwood furniture; rather than remaining static, the antique copper patina achieved through the authentic French hot process responds to touch and time. As you use your sink, areas of high contact may subtly shift in tone, creating a rich, multi-dimensional appearance that is entirely unique to your kitchen. This natural evolution is a hallmark of genuine copper fixtures, offering an organic beauty that manufactured coatings simply cannot replicate.
Installation Guide
Measure your custom cabinetry and countertop cutout carefully to ensure a proper fit for the 36 inch farmhouse apron configuration.
Ensure adequate under-cabinet structural support is installed to bear the weight of the solid copper basin.
Connect a compatible 3-1/2 inch drain assembly, sold separately, using plumber putty and standard plumbing guidelines.
Check all water and waste connections for secure alignment before putting the sink into regular daily service.
Care & Maintenance
Daily Cleaning Wash the copper surface regularly with mild soap and warm water using a soft sponge or cloth.
Rinse Thoroughly Rinse the basin completely after each use to prevent soap film or mineral residue buildup.
Avoid Harsh Chemicals Never use abrasive scouring pads, steel wool, or harsh chemical bleach cleaners that can damage the patina.
Patina Maintenance Embrace the natural living finish as it darkens and evolves organically over time.
Dry After Use Wipe the sink dry with a soft towel periodically to maintain the polished antique copper appearance.
